As a global manufacturer of light alloy wheels, BORBET will once again be exhibiting at the leading platform for the global tyre and wheel industry in 2024. At THE TIRE COLOGNE trade fair, the 140 square metre BORBET stand will focus on new wheel designs that represent a novelty in the product range and set new technological standards.BORBET is actively shaping pioneering solutions for the vehicles of tomorrow. This is also demonstrated by the presentation of innovations in the area of surface finishing as well as a cooperation in the area of sustainability and secondary aluminium. A joint project between leading companies and research institutes is examining how sustainable the aluminium wheel of the future can be. It combines technical, economic and environmental aspects as well as the requirements of different drive systems.

In times of sustainability debates andCO2 limits, car manufacturers are increasingly focusing on wheels. This is because wheels not only determine the "look and feel" of a vehicle, but also its driving characteristics and fuel consumption.
SUSTAINABLE CONCEPTS FOR THE MOBILITY OF TOMORROW.

Above all, weight and aerodynamics are currently the most influential parameters for fuel consumption andCO2 emissions or for the range, which is so crucial for electric vehicles. Depending on the vehicle concept, this can ideally be increased by up to 15%. Aerodynamic drag plays the decisive role here. Although smaller wheels are generally more wind-slippery than larger ones, a larger diameter wheel also reduces the rolling resistance or contact area of the tire.
In addition to size, there are other ways to improve handling characteristics - and these are hidden in the details. For example, in a completely aerodynamically closed wheel design, where the cooling of the brakes is not neglected. BORBET has developed a new concept in which small, intelligent inserts play a major role. A second concept shows solutions for using sustainable inserts made from renewable raw materials.
The wheel experts from BORBET will be demonstrating how wheel development can be fundamentally and sustainably changed by both concepts by presenting two new concepts to the world at THE TIRE COLOGNE 2022:
New Driving Coolness through BORBET ACTIVE AERO WHEEL
This wheel concept combines the factors of wheel weight, aerodynamics and brake cooling and ensures a completely new level of performance thanks to automatically closing insert flaps.
The wheel as the base carrier has a new stylistic design and has been optimized in production using the weight-reducing FlowForming and Undercut lightweight construction technologies. The wheel weight in the 8.0x19 inch size is just 9.2 kg. Ten inserts ensure a 100% closed wheel surface and enable maximum flow optimization. To cool the brakes, five inserts are opened during driving by means of thermal actuators. This revolutionary technology ensures the appropriate "driving coolness".
More sustainability thanks to NATURAL FIBER INSERTS
The sustainability of BORBET alloy wheels is currently demonstrated, for example, by the ASI certification and the GOLD award from ecovadis. In February 2022, BORBET became the first wheel manufacturer in the world to have all of its production sites certified by the ASI. The decisive factor here is, among other things, the sustainable use of the raw material aluminum in the production of a wheel.
This commitment to greater sustainability is now being continued with aerodynamic inserts. The i-ATX concept bike with NATURAL FIBER INSERTS fulfills our claim by using renewable raw materials. The special AERO inserts are woven from a flax material, as known from the "carbon" sector, and are therefore made from a regenerative natural material. Similar to carbon components, these inserts have a very appealing sporty look as well as a low product weight with maximum stability.
The i-ATX wheel weighs just 14.7 kg and can cope with high wheel and axle loads. It optimizes the airflow around the wheel, making the car more streamlined. The NATURAL FIBER INSERTS show how sustainable, innovative and forward-looking the use of new materials can be and that the look is not neglected either.

BORBET Thüringen GmbH, Europe's largest and most modern production plant for light alloy wheels, is redefining mobility and sustainability. The site in Bad Langensalza has the latest production technologies and an in-house customisation centre. Here, BORBET focuses on innovative insert solutions, among other things, which enable new design aspects in combination with the reduction of wheel weight and aerodynamic drag. Another pioneering technology from BORBET Thüringen GmbH is pad printing, which guarantees precise and durable customisation options.
